AREA Launches 3rd Edition of Women in Cooling Video Competition

AREA and World Refrigeration Day (WRD) have announced the third edition of their video competition celebrating best practices among EU women in the cooling industry. This initiative aims to highlight the skills and contributions of women in the refrigeration, air conditioning, and heat pump (RACHP) sectors.

Participants are invited to submit videos focusing on one of two themes:
  • Category A - RACHP Best Practice Mastery: Showcasing skills in handling refrigeration, air conditioning, or heat pump systems.
  • Category B - RACHP Design Excellence: Demonstrating design and application expertise in RACHP systems.
Participants should upload their video privately on AREA’s Facebook page, "AREA," or email it to info@area-eur.be by midnight on Sunday, May 4, 2025. Submissions are welcome in all European languages, encouraging diverse representation from across the continent.

This competition provides an excellent opportunity for women in cooling to showcase their talent and advance their professional visibility.
